auto_xy_Add¶
Erzeugt einen neuen Datensatz aus der Summe der y-Koordinaten der angegebenen 2D-Datensätze.
- hDataNew = auto_xy_Add(hData, hvData)
- hDataNew = auto_xy_Add(hData_Layer, hvData)
Returnwert
hDataNew ist die Zugriffsnummer des neu erzeugten 2D-Datensatzes.
Parameter
- hData
hData ist die Zugriffsnummer (Handle) des Datensatzes auf den die Funktion angewendet werden soll. Der erzeugte Datensatz wird dem Diagramm zugefügt, in dem sich hData befindet.
- hData_Layer
hData_Layer ist ein Vektor von Zugriffsnummern. Das erste Element ist die Zugriffsnummer (Handle) des Datensatzes auf den die Funktion angewendet werden soll. Das zweite Element ist die Zugriffsnummer (Handle) des Diagramms, dem der neue Datensatz zugefügt werden soll.
- hvData
hvData ist ein Vektor mit weiteren 2D Datensatz Zugriffsnummern.
Kommentar
Die x-Koordinaten aller Datensätze müssen monoton aufsteigend sein. Die Stützstellen (x-Koordinaten) der Datensätz müssen nicht identisch sein.
Der neue Datensatz wird wie folgt erzeugt:
Es wird der Überlappungsbereich der x-Koordinaten bestimmt.
Innerhalb dieses Bereichs wird ein neuer Stützstellen-Vektor xs berechnet, der die Stützstellen aller Datensätze enthält.
Für jeden Datensatz werden für den neuen Stützstellen-Vektor die y-Koordinaten durch lineare Interpolation berechnet.
Die interpolierten y-Koordinaten werden addiert (yadd).
Der neue Datensatz wird erzeugt (xs, yadd).
id-1624966